Understanding skin types is the foundation of effective care. The primary categories include normal, dry, oily, combination, and sensitive skin, each with unique characteristics and needs. Normal skin maintains balance and elasticity with minimal issues, while dry skin requires extra hydration and gentle treatment to prevent flaking and irritation. Oily skin benefits from lightweight, non-comedogenic products that control excess sebum. Combination skin demands a nuanced approach to address both dry and oily areas, and sensitive skin necessitates hypoallergenic formulations to avoid reactions. Tailoring products and routines to skin type ensures optimal results and reduces the risk of irritation or imbalance.

Lifestyle choices significantly influence skin health. Adequate hydration supports cellular function and keeps the skin supple, while a balanced diet rich in vitamins, minerals, and healthy fats nourishes the skin from within. Exercise promotes blood circulation, delivering oxygen and nutrients that enhance complexion and natural radiance. Quality sleep allows the body to repair and regenerate skin cells, reducing puffiness and dullness. Stress management is equally critical, as chronic stress can trigger inflammation, breakouts, and sensitivity. A holistic approach that integrates nutrition, hydration, movement, and relaxation complements topical treatments for optimal skin health.
Advances in skin care science have provided targeted solutions for a variety of concerns. Chemical exfoliants and gentle acids help remove dead skin cells and improve texture, while retinoids and peptides stimulate collagen production and reduce fine lines. Professional treatments such as facials, microdermabrasion, and laser therapies enhance results and address persistent concerns. Personalized skin care routines, informed by individual needs and environmental factors, maximize effectiveness and reduce adverse reactions.
